Elm City Montessori School, launched in August 2014, is New Havens first public Montessori school. We are seeking a Social Emotional Learning Coordinator to support us in building a vibrant and healthy learning environment in our new and growing school. We will serve 260 children preK-6th grade in the 2020-2021 academic year and will grow to more than 370 students between the ages of 3 and 13 over the next ten years. New Haven, Connecticut is a thriving arts, cultural, and education hub, located in the center of a growing community of public Montessori schools.\

About the Position: This is a 10 month, full-time position. As part of the SEL and Student Support will be responsible for planning social emotional learning. This person reports to the Principal and coordinates with Guides, Assistants, Student Support and Social Worker.\
Required Qualifications: Applicant must have a BA and a minimum of 2-3 years of professional and lived experience in a school or early childhood program.\
Preferred Qualifications: The ideal applicant is well-organized, positive, proactive, and motivated. They are familiar with the Montessori Method of education, has experience in early childhood, has strong communication skills, has coached and managed teams, and possesses a strong desire to involve families in their childrens education. Bilingual (Spanish) is preferred. \
\
Key Components of the Position:\
Planning and managing support plans for students\
Coordinating with leadership, staff, and parents to support students\
Planning and facilitating restorative processes\
Supporting social emotional learning for staff through coaching and professional learning\
\
Areas of Responsibility\
Children\
Review referral data, history and work with Student Support Team to plan supports for children.\
Support Principal in maintaining accurate records in accordance with State and District regulations and legal requirements\
Work with Principal to share progress reports about students with staff, parents, and leadership team\
Plans and facilitates restorative practices with children proactively and based on need\
\
Families\
Maintain regular communication with parents, email, phone, meetings, and progress reports\
Partner with parents in understanding and supporting educational supports and objectives\
Document communication and planning with parents and share with leadership team\
\
Staff\
Participates in coaching through observation and data collection from Guides, Montessori Coach and Social Worker\
Help plan SEL Team, Coach, Social Worker and Leadership to plan for professional learning\
Monitor and support Guides and Assistants in implementation of supports for children and outreach to families\
\
Climate/Safety\
Support healthy classroom environments and school policies to create a safe and focused learning environment\
Collaborate with Principal and to support individual students and school environment\
Support the implementation of SEL Skills for children and in classrooms\
Plans and facilitates restorative circles in classrooms\
\
Community\
Participate in outreach events (Including Family Conferences(if needed), Orientations, Open House, and 6 additional Family Events)\
Represent the school at meetings, events, conferences focused on social-emotional learning\
\
Collaboration and Professional Learning\
Communicates and interacts regularly and appropriately with students, faculty, staff and administration, maintaining positive relationships\
Meets regularly with classroom team, engaging in planning of activities \
Attends and actively participates in all require professional learning and events including work with Social Emotional Learning, Academics, and ABAR\
